- [ ] Step 7: Archive cold storage buckets (Glacierline tier). Confirm both ceremony witnesses are present, verify bucket manifests match the Oxbow ledger, then seal the archive key shares. Plugin authors may observe but not handle shares. Once sealed, the archive index itself is encrypted and can only be reopened with the passphrase below.

vault phrase of badup-hahig = tamael-aldael-kelmir-istael-fenok-istwyn-tamius-jorath-oliion

This page documents the caps introduced after the reconnect storm incident in the Pushgate websocket layer. The bug: clients dropped by a node restart all retried at once with no jitter, saturating the load balancer and triggering cascading disconnects. The fix adds exponential backoff with full jitter, a per-client reconnect budget, and a server-side admission quota. Reviewers should verify any change against these caps, since exceeding them re-opens the storm scenario. The enforced constants are shown below.

limits module of yadug-tawip:
QUOTAS = {
    "julael": 705,
    "kasael": 903,
    "druwyn": 489,
}

MEMO TO THE BOARD — Legacy Price Increase

Effective with the spring renewal cycle, customers on legacy Copperline contracts will move to current list pricing, phased over two renewal periods. Finance projects a net revenue lift of roughly 6% with modeled churn under 3%. Account teams have retention playbooks ready, and Hale Voss will report monthly on attrition. The strategic rationale is stated in the note below.

management briefing: Jorixax Holdings is in early talks to buy Casixax Holdings for about $420.3 million. The Fenmir launch date is October 27, and nothing goes to the press before then. Legal wants the Keloxek Foods term sheet redrafted before April 16.

## Runbook: Canary Gating Rules

For the weekly sync: Driftgate canaries promote automatically only when error rate stays under 0.5% and p95 latency within 10% of baseline for 30 minutes. Any manual override must be logged in the gating table with a reason. Rollbacks reset the observation window. Gate decisions and override history are stored in the deploy-metrics database; query it using the connection string below.

primary connection of hadup-kajeg = clickhouse://rusath_svc:lTa6pgZ@db-a477.plorvaforge.corp:5432/oliox